Drilling

Tools for drilling The Walter and Walter Titex competence brands provide a full range of products for efficient drilling operations. The standard range of solid drills starts at a diameter of 0.05 mm and ends at a diameter of 100 mm. A wide range of systems with indexable inserts or drill inserts as well as systems made from solid carbide or HSS is available. In addition to analogue tools, digital solutions with balance compensation are available for counterboring and precision boring operations. Maximum precision and easy handling increase process reliability and productivity. For reaming operations, Walter offers solid carbide or HSS tools with multiple cutting edges, as well as various versions of pad-guided reaming tools with exchangeable cutting edges.

XD Technology [from page B 101] – Drilling without pecking up to 50 × Dc as a standard tool and up to 70 × Dc as a special tool – For versatile use in many different materials

2

Xtra·tec® Point Drill [from page B 198] – Solid drilling tool with drill insert for all drilled holes up to 10 × Dc – Patented clamping provides maximum process reliability

3

UFL® XPL high-performance drill made from HSS-E [from page B 262] – UFL® XPL tools offer a long tool life for universal use – HSS-E provides good temperature resistance and the XPL coating ensures maximum wear resistance

Solid carbide and HSS centre drill [from page B 396] – Our product range includes dimensions in accordance with DIN 333 and the associated forms A, R and B

4 X·treme solid carbide chamfer drill [from page B 27] – Pilot hole drilling and countersinking can be performed in a single operation – Other dimensions and stages can be supplied by the Walter Xpress Service within two weeks
